Composer and Autoloading


To add your own code to the autoloader by adding an autoload field to

"autoload": {
"psr-4": {"Acme\\": "src/"}

Update Composer from terminal:

composer update

This will generate a vendor directory containing dependencies.

Hope your application entry point is index.php.

So, import autoload.php file from vendor directory.

require __DIR__ . '/vendor/autoload.php';

Dump autoloading using composer.

composer dump-autoload

Above command will just regenerates the list of all classes that need to be included in the project (autoload_classmap.php).


